The letter of 1 Corinthians is a written response to the issues that threatened to damage and weaken the young, growing church. Paul was in Ephesus when he received news about what was happening in Corinth. Paul began his letter to the Corinthians by addressing the heart of their problems. These first verses were preserved as Scripture, making Paul’s words as relevant to people today as they were to the ancient church in Corinth.

Let’s explore how we can influence the culture with the truth of God’s word through 1 and 2 Corinthians! These two letters are a powerful message from the Apostle Paul to a church that was passionate about its mission but needed direction to remain true to its Christian faith and doctrines. Those priorities make his letters important teaching for every Christian.
